Key buying criteria

  • Screen size. Compact for a nightstand; larger for the kitchen.
  • Camera shutter. A physical shutter protects privacy.
  • Camera-feed support. Confirm it shows your cameras.

Setup and usage tips

  • Put it where you glance. Nightstand or kitchen counter.
  • Pin a camera view. For quick front-door checks.
  • Use the shutter. Cover the camera when idle.

Common mistakes to avoid

  • Ignoring the camera. Use the shutter/mic-off when not needed.
  • Wrong ecosystem. Match it to your devices.
  • Oversizing. The compact Show 5 suits most rooms.
